The Evolution of 3D Printing:

Three-dimensional (3D) printing, also known as additive manufacturing, involves creating objects by layering materials based on a digital design. The technology has come a long way since its inception in the 1980s. Initially used for rapid prototyping, 3D printing has now expanded its capabilities to produce complex objects, customized products, and even bio-printing of human organs.

Benefits of 3D Printing Services:

1. Rapid Prototyping: 3D printing enables rapid prototyping, reducing the time and cost associated with traditional manufacturing processes. With quick iterations and precise designs, businesses can accelerate their product development cycle.

2. Customization: 3D printing allows for highly customized products, catering to the specific needs and preferences of individuals. From personalized jewelry to tailor-made prosthetics, the technology offers a new level of personalization and uniqueness.

3. Cost and Resource Efficiency: By using only the required amount of raw materials and minimizing waste, 3D printing ensures cost and resource efficiency. Traditional subtractive manufacturing methods generate significant amounts of waste, whereas additive manufacturing produces minimal waste.

4. Design Freedom: With 3D printing, designers have the freedom to create intricate and complex geometries that are challenging or impossible to achieve using conventional manufacturing methods. This unlocks limitless design possibilities.

5. Supply Chain Optimization: 3D printing enables on-demand production, reducing inventory costs and supply chain complexities. With 3D printers placed strategically, businesses can produce components or products wherever and whenever needed, avoiding long lead times and transportation costs.

Impact on Different Industries:

1. Healthcare: 3D printing has revolutionized the field of healthcare by facilitating custom prosthetics, surgical guides, anatomical models for preoperative planning, and even bio-printing human tissues and organs. The technology has the potential to save lives and improve patient outcomes.

2. Automotive: The automotive industry is leveraging 3D printing for prototyping, producing spare parts, and creating lightweight components. This enhances vehicle performance, reduces manufacturing costs, and supports sustainable practices.

3. Architecture and Construction: Architects and construction professionals are increasingly adopting 3D printing for creating intricate scale models, prototypes, and even entire houses. This technology not only speeds up the design process but also allows for more sustainable construction practices.

4. Education: 3D printing enables hands-on learning experiences and fosters creativity among students. Schools and universities in Pune can leverage this technology to enhance STEAM (Science, Technology, Engineering, Art, and Mathematics) education.

3D printing materials

Plastics

One of the most commonly used 3D printing materials. These materials include ABS, PLA, PETG, TPU, PEEK, etc. Each material has different physical and chemical properties and can be suitable for different application scenarios.

Metal

Metal 3D printing materials include titanium alloy, aluminum alloy, stainless steel, nickel alloy, etc. Metal 3D printing can produce complex components and molds, with advantages such as high strength and high wear resistance.

Ceramic

Ceramic 3D printing materials include alumina, zirconia, silicate, etc. Ceramic 3D printing can produce high-precision ceramic products, such as ceramic parts, ceramic sculptures, etc.
